Hi Theres no set answer to this question as well, best bet is to get and experiment with a roller tuning kit www.scooterworks.com/prima-roller-weight-tuning-kit--3g-to-14g--16x13-products-1935.phpOnce you find the proper weight for your performance needs then go with a set of quality rollers or sliders as the tuning kit rollers are not for daily use and will wear down quickly, they are only for tuning purposes i recomend DR Pully Or NYC If you decide to get sliders over rollers go up one gram in weight as opposed to rollers So if a good weight with rollers is 7 grams use 8 gram sliders Take care and ride safely Yours Hank
